Hi! I''m not sure whether this is the right way (TM) to give you this information or whether it should be filled in bug reports... Anyway. First, let me thank you for the integration work, after switching from apt-get to aptitude the upgrade was a breeze. There were no "show stoppers" only a few glitches which I''m reporting: When I added a start icon for the showimg application to my panel I didn''t get the appropriate icon. I fixed this by copying the /usr/share/applications/kde/gwenview.desktop file to showimg.desktop and modifyed it with a text editor. The other applications showed their correct icon. Should I file a bug report? When updating kmail I used aptitude -t experimental install kontact and expected that kmail would automagically be updated to. But it wasn''t. Shouldn''t there be a dependency taking care of this? After aptitude upgraded kmail (from the KDE 3.5.9 Version to KDE 4.1 version) the start icon I added to the panel didn''t start kmail anymore. I manually set the desktop file path in .kde4/share/config/plasma-appletsrc to Url=file:///usr/share/applications/kde4/KMail.desktop restarted the desktop and kmail launches again. So I expect that with other KDE programs making their transition from KDE 3 to KDE 4 they will face the same problem. kmail started and told me that this was the first start and I should do some configuration. I aborted kmail, copied my .kde/share/apps/kmail directory to .kde4/share/apps as well as the files .kde/share/config/kmailrc and .kde/share/config/kmail.eventsrc After starting kmail again everything was in place except my identity as well as my accounts sending settings. I had to configure them via the settings menu. Is there any transition tool planed for such situations? That''s it for the start, I guess I''ve forgotten other things ..., but maybe this is helpful though. regards matthias

The other applications showed their correct > icon. > Should I file a bug report?Yes, it''s a bug to be addressed in the gwenview package.> When updating kmail I used > aptitude -t experimental install kontact > and expected that kmail would automagically be updated to. But it wasn''t. > Shouldn''t there be a dependency taking care of this?The kontact > kmail recommend is not versionned. Anyway, the proper way to do this would be to upgrade the kdepim meta-package which has the right dependencies. I think it should be considered a bug anyway.> After aptitude upgraded kmail (from the KDE 3.5.9 Version to KDE 4.1 > version) the start icon I added to the panel didn''t start kmail anymore. I had to configure them via the > settings menu. Is there any transition tool planed for such situations?Last two issues are migration issues we don''t have a policy about yet. There have been some talks about this in the team. I didn''t know the panel issue btw, but don''t see an easy way to fix it automatically. Regards -- Xavier Vello

Felipe Sateler wrote:> Does the new kontact work with the old kmail? If not, a conflicts may be > needed.I''d imagine you will simply have the new kontact without any mail functionality, and you can continue to use the old kmail. Which would be weird but not implausible during the transition period. A conflict would simply cause the old kmail to be uninstalled, which would not benefit kontact''s mail functionality one way or another.
